The Ash Surgery

The Ash Surgery was established at 1 Ashfield Road in 1989 Dr Johnson left the practice recently March 2024. Dr Lynn, Dr McCabe and Dr Miller are the current 3 partners. 

The team of doctors includes 5 Salaried GP’s, Dr Morris, Dr Daniel and Dr Jermin, Dr Wilkinson and Dr McAvoy  and in addition, as a training practice, has GP Registrar’s.  Each of the doctors have their own special areas of interest and expertise.

The nursing team is led by our senior nurse, Sister Karen Rietdyk, who is supported with additional clinics by Sister Shelley Blunden.  They have been established at The Ash Surgery for many years and provide essential support to patient care.

The clinicians are supported by an often behind the scenes team who used to be recognised as receptionists and administrators.  The role of the clinical support team has changed dramatically over the past few years.  In addition to the everyday duties of paperwork and answering the phones, the team are skilled at navigating appointment so that patients are directed to the most appropriate health care clinicians.  There are 5 full time and 3 part time members of the team, 7 who are trained to do blood pressure clinics and 6 who are trained flu vaccinators.

Our practice secretary has over 20 years of experience and has a vital role in supporting the clinicians.  She has a vast knowledge of referrals and access to community and secondary care services.  In addition she supports the clinicians with the management of cancer patients and high risk drug monitoring.
